48 Sidewalks Development in Jakarta Has Touched 25 Percent

Jakarta Bina Marga Dept. is developing 48 sidewalks in the capital. Thus far, its development progress has reached 25 percent of total 80 kilometers.

Until now it has touched 25 percent at 48 spots

Yusmada Faizal, Head of Jakarta Bina Marga Dept. believes it can be completed on time. Considering, there is still a few months to complete the project.

"Until now it has touched 25 percent at 48 spots," he expressed, at City Hall, Monday (9/11).

This year, he stated, it is targeted to be made up to 100 kilometers.

"There is a reduction in the length of the sidewalk being worked on. That is from the original at 100 to 80 kilometers. Last year we only did 50 kilometers," he told.

Of 48 spots, he added, 8 of them are handled by Bina Marga Dept. And the rest 40 spots are handled by each Bina Marga Sub-dept.
